Yakubu Alfa's piledriver against Colombia in the Round of 16 at the FIFA U-17 World Cup Korea 2007 has been voted as the Goal of the Tournament by FIFA.com users.
It has proved to be a successful tournament for the Golden Eaglets: not only did they win the competition and boast adidas Golden Shoe winner Macauley Chrisantus in their ranks, but now they can claim that they scored FIFA.com's Goal of the Tournament.
However, the result was close: just 0.1 of a star separated the Nigerian's goal from Yoichiro Kakitani's cheeky lob against France in Goyang. In third place was Ransford Osei's goal against Germany, which yielded an average of 4.2 stars.
